Slow Cooked Pinto Chicken with Corn and Quinoa

This slow cooked pinto chicken with corn and quinoa recipe is a delicious way to switch up your usual weeknight dinner routine. Plus, it's a one-pot meal!

Ingredients
  

  • 1 lb 16oz of chicken breast trimmed and cut into large chunks
  • 1 15 oz can of cream style corn
  • 1 15 oz can of pinto beans rinsed and drained
  • 1 15 oz can of diced tomatoes
  • ½ teaspoon ground sage
  • 1 teaspoon dried chives
  • 1 teaspoon dehydrated onion
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on dried cilantro
  • 1 cup 170g uncooked Quinoa

Instructions
 

  • Put all ingredients except quinoa in a crock pot on low and cook for about 6 hours.

  • A half an hour before dinner, add the quinoa. It will soak up the remaining liquid.
